Young is not that terrible, but Jay Cutler has been moving up his odds and with that is pushing so hard on Vince because every team is always open to draft a franchise QB but also everybody avoids a Ryan Leaf situation.
Cutler is adding points because he did it great while preparing for Senior Bowl, where nobody expected much on him, and he showed solid, natural, confident and very skilled under an NFL-like playbook. His best features were pocket abilities, precision throwing, great timming and excellent arm power.
Vince will have to deal with that and upgrade his mechanicals and somehow show the NFL he's able to be a pocket QB.
